tpaivaa commented Dec 6, 2019

noticed that when following the install guide on sources

sudo apt-get install apache2 libapache2-mod-php php-curl
Reading package lists... Done
Building dependency tree
Reading state information... Done
Some packages could not be installed. This may mean that you have
requested an impossible situation or if you are using the unstable
distribution that some required packages have not yet been created
or been moved out of Incoming.
The following information may help to resolve the situation:

The following packages have unmet dependencies:
php-curl : Depends: php7.2-curl but it is not going to be installed
E: Unable to correct problems, you have held broken packages.

I was able to go pass this with
sudo apt install libcurl4
and after that the
sudo apt-get install apache2 libapache2-mod-php php-curl
worked.
